continuity

UK/,kɒntɪ'njuːɪtɪ/US/.kɒnti'nju:iti/
IELTSTOEFLB1

Definitions

n.

The state of going on without interruption; an unbroken connection

连续性;连贯性

n.

Consistency of details across the parts of a film or story

(影视)连贯性;衔接

Root Breakdown

Root-derived
con-together, with
+
tinuhold, keep
+
-itystate, quality, condition
=continuity

continue + -ity = the state of being continuous, the unbroken thread. Used for smooth succession (continuity of care, business continuity) and for the film-craft sense of keeping details consistent between shots.
